In its Q1 2022 investor letter, Diamond Hill International Fund mentioned Spotify Technology S.A. (NYSE:SPOT) and explained its insights for the company. Founded in 2006, Spotify Technology S.A. (NYSE:SPOT) is a Stockholm, Sweden-based entertainment services provider with an $18.5 billion market capitalization. Spotify Technology S.A. (NYSE:SPOT) delivered a -58.84% return since the beginning of the year, while its 12-month returns are down by -60.40%. The stock closed at $96.32 per share on July 14, 2022.

Here is what Diamond Hill International Fund Concentrated Fund has to say about Spotify Technology S.A. (NYSE:SPOT) in its Q1 2022 investor letter:

Spotify’s stock sold off in Q1 despite strong fundamental results. We believe the sell-off was due to several exogenous factors, including the interest rate policy shift, public backlash over Joe Rogan content, as well as continued skepticism by some around the company’s decision to step up growth investments again, thus calling into question the business’s longer-term ability to scale. We used the period of weakness to add to our position.”
